Sleep for pregnancy: 5 ways to improve the quality of your slumber
It’s a well known fact that a multitude of issues keep expectant mums wide awake while the rest of us slumber.
These issues can include anxiety, nausea, leg cramps, back pain and more. Then, towards the end of a pregnancy other factors can often arise such as recurring heartburn and the notorious ‘Shrinking Bladder Syndrome’ all of which compound to make sleep even more elusive.
